# Pairwise matcher service — GC pause tuning.
# Plugin authors: hooks run inside the matcher heap. Keep allocations small;
# pauses over 50ms drop your plugin from the match cycle.
# MATCH_HEAP_MB and GC_TARGET_MS are tunable below.
# Plugins authenticating to the broker need the shared broker credential,
# which must appear on the next line.

secret setting of kawip-tajop: RELAY_SECRET8=11ecb20c

### Audit item 7: Bulk edits in the admin table

Hey plugin folks — if your extension touches the Gridlume admin table, bulk edits are the thing we check hardest. Confirm your plugin respects the `bulk_cap` gate, writes one audit row per affected record (not per batch!), and refuses batches over 500 rows without a confirmation step. We've seen plugins silently skip validation on bulk paths, so please test with mixed valid/invalid rows. Questions or exception requests go to the audit owner named below.

approver of kafog-yageg = Briwyn Sorwyn Gilmir

### Deploy: MegaDiff 2.4

Quick note for the sync: MegaDiff, our viewer for multi-gigabyte file diffs, ships to the Arbordale cluster on Thursday. The chunked-rendering path is now default, so expect lower memory on the render nodes. Run the smoke suite against a 5 GB fixture before promoting. The release pipeline signs the container with the key below.

rollout seal: bky4_x7Gc

## Divestiture of the Kestrelline Tooling Unit (Managers Only)

This page summarises the planned sale of the Kestrelline Tooling unit to Marrowvale Holdings. As incoming director, please review the staffing transition schedule and the Ostwich plant lease terms before the handover call. Valuation assumptions were prepared by Dorran Veile and remain subject to final audit. The confidential note on forward business plans is appended directly below.

management briefing: Gross margin on Ralael came in at 15 percent against a plan of 10 percent. Only 9 of the 100 pilot accounts renewed Ralael, so a churn review is set for April 1.